温馨提示×

Debian日志中如何识别系统警告

小樊
50
2025-10-20 13:16:51
栏目: 智能运维

在Debian系统中,日志文件通常位于/var/log目录下

  1. 使用journalctl命令查看系统日志:

    journalctl是systemd的日志管理工具,可以用来查看和管理系统日志。要查看所有日志,只需运行以下命令:

    journalctl
    

    若要查看特定时间段的日志,可以使用-b选项指定启动次数,或使用--since--until选项指定日期和时间范围。例如,要查看自上次启动以来的警告日志,可以运行:

    journalctl -b -p 1
    

    其中,-p 1表示仅显示警告(Priority 1)及以上级别的日志。

  2. 查看/var/log/syslog文件:

    在Debian系统中,/var/log/syslog文件包含了大部分系统日志信息。要查看此文件中的警告信息,可以使用grep命令进行筛选。例如:

    grep -i 'warning' /var/log/syslog
    

    这将显示所有包含“warning”(不区分大小写)的日志条目。

  3. 查看特定服务的日志:

    有时,您可能只想查看特定服务的日志。在这种情况下,可以直接查看该服务在/var/log目录下的日志文件。例如,要查看Apache Web服务器的警告日志,可以运行:

    cat /var/log/apache2/error.log | grep -i 'warning'
    

    这将显示Apache错误日志中所有包含“warning”的条目。

通过以上方法,您可以在Debian系统的日志中识别出警告信息。请注意,日志文件可能会变得非常大,因此定期清理和归档旧日志是一个好习惯。

0